WebMay 17, 2008 · The smaller the boat, the more you have to watch the weather, not take chances, and make sure your maintenance has been done. The great lakes are big enough to sink any boat if it's mishandled, in the wrong conditions, or someone does something risky or stupid. The Fitzgerald was 729 feet long and it sank in a storm in 530 feet of water. The trick to buying a boat is to purchase one that is large enough to suit your needs … WebMar 10, 2024 · 3. Buying a boat is easy, finding a place to put it—not so much. It can be very challenging to find a place to moor your boat. The best places to live aboard a boat often involve waitlists and permitting. Many big cities have liveaboard licensing …
